HAWAIIAN CHICKEN AND PEARS

Quick to prepare, this meal combines veggies, pears and pineapple with chicken. You can substitute canned sliced water chestnuts for the cashew nuts the next time you make it. Recipe can easily be doubled. Always be sure to use ripe pears if not using canned.

Time 30m

Yield 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 11

4 fresh Anjou pears or 4 canned pears
1 lb chicken, sliced into 2 x 1/2 x 1/2 inch strips
3 tablespoons butter or 3 tablespoons margarine
1 (8 ounce) can pineapple chunks
1 green pepper, seeded and sliced
1/2 cup cashew nuts
2 tablespoons packed brown sugar
1 tablespoon cornstarch
1/3 cup water
2 tablespoons soy sauce
1/2 teaspoon vinegar

Steps:

  • Core and slice pears, if using fresh. Sauté chicken in butter 3 to 5 minutes or until juices run clear. Drain pineapple; reserve 1/3 cup liquid.
  • Add pears, pineapple, green pepper and cashews to chicken; heat thoroughly.
  • Combine brown sugar, cornstarch, reserved pineapple liquid, water, vinegar and soy sauce in saucepan. Cook and stir over low heat until mixture thickens; cook 1 minute longer. Pour sauce over pear-chicken mixture and toss gently. Warm to serving temperature.
  • I sometimes add extra white sugar to sweeten it to my liking, and always double the sauce.
